How do I replace a fan clutch cable on a chevrolet trailblazer

There is no "fan clutch cable." To replace the fan clutch, remove the fan shroud and remove the four screws that attach the fan and clutch assembly to the water pump. Once you have removed the fan and clutch assembly, remove the retaining screws that affix the fan blades to the clutch, and reverse the process with the new fan clutch.

2003 chevy trailblazer cooling temp running 230

Smart man using a scanner for the actual temp. Assuming you're not losing coolant....2 things I'd look at here, 1st is you may have air in the system, make sure to purge all the air. 2nd is your fan clutch, I've replaced a few fan clutches in my own Trailblazer. Have had them bad right out of the box brand new. Have had bad brand new fan clutches on 2 of my last Trailblazers. You should hear it engaging especially in stop and go traffic.

2004 trailblazer, 2 wheel drive. Code P0526, fan clutch circuit. Replaced fan clutch. Still code P0526. Wiring ok. Check Engine Light still on.

A couple of things come to mind. Double check the wiring at the fan clutch, check the whole harness, there is a known problem wth chaffing there. Is it a Dorman brand fan clutch? These have been known to be bad out of the box. The other thing that could be wrong is the actual speed sensor on the new fan clutch. Hope some of this helps.

I have a 2003 Chevrolet Trailblazer EXT LT with a 5.3, The cooling fan is constantly running, no codes, the relay and fuse are good, what else could it be?

Need to replace your fan clutch. It's constantly engaged, sounding like an airplane. Common problem for Trailblazers and Envoys.
